Test 244 checks the expected behavior of qcow2 external data files
with respect to zero and discarded clusters.  Filesystems however
are free to ignore discard requests, and this seems to be the
case for overlayfs.  Relax the tests to skip checks on the
external data file for discarded areas, which implies not using
qemu-img compare in the data_file_raw=on case.

This fixes docker tests on RHEL8.

If BDRV_REQ_ZERO_WRITE is set and we're extending the image, calling
qcow2_cluster_zeroize() with flags=0 does the right thing: It doesn't
undo any previous preallocation, but just adds the zero flag to all
relevant L2 entries. If an external data file is in use, a write_zeroes
request to the data file is made instead.

When extending the size of an image that has a backing file larger than
its old size, make sure that the backing file data doesn't become
visible in the guest, but the added area is properly zeroed out.

Consider the following scenario where the overlay is shorter than its
backing file:

    base.qcow2:     AAAAAAAA
    overlay.qcow2:  BBBB

When resizing (extending) overlay.qcow2, the new blocks should not stay
unallocated and make the additional As from base.qcow2 visible like
before this patch, but zeros should be read.

A similar case happens with the various variants of a commit job when an
intermediate file is short (- for unallocated):

    base.qcow2:     A-A-AAAA
    mid.qcow2:      BB-B
    top.qcow2:      C--C--C-

After commit top.qcow2 to mid.qcow2, the following happens:

    mid.qcow2:      CB-C00C0 (correct result)
    mid.qcow2:      CB-C--C- (before this fix)

Without the fix, blocks that previously read as zeros on top.qcow2
suddenly turn into A.

The BDRV_REQ_ZERO_WRITE is currently implemented in a way that first the
image is possibly preallocated and then the zero flag is added to all
clusters. This means that a copy-on-write operation may be needed when
writing to these clusters, despite having used preallocation, negating
one of the major benefits of preallocation.

Instead, try to forward the BDRV_REQ_ZERO_WRITE to the protocol driver,
and if the protocol driver can ensure that the new area reads as zeros,
we can skip setting the zero flag in the qcow2 layer.

Unfortunately, the same approach doesn't work for metadata
preallocation, so we'll still set the zero flag there.

This patch introduces support for PMR that has been defined as part of NVMe 1.4
spec. User can now specify a pmrdev option that should point to HostMemoryBackend.
pmrdev memory region will subsequently be exposed as PCI BAR 2 in emulated NVMe
device. Guest OS can perform mmio read and writes to the PMR region that will stay
persistent across system reboot.

The QMP handler qmp_object_add() and the implementation of --object in
qemu-storage-daemon can share most of the code. Currently,
qemu-storage-daemon calls qmp_object_add(), but this is not correct
because different visitors need to be used.

As a first step towards a fix, make qmp_object_add() a wrapper around a
new function user_creatable_add_dict() that can get an additional
parameter. The handling of "props" is only required for compatibility
and not required for the qemu-storage-daemon command line, so it stays
in qmp_object_add().

After processing the option string with the keyval parser, we get a
QDict that contains only strings. This QDict must be fed to a keyval
visitor which converts the strings into the right data types.

qmp_object_add(), however, uses the normal QObject input visitor, which
expects a QDict where all properties already have the QType that matches
the data type required by the QOM object type.

Change the --object implementation in qemu-storage-daemon so that it
doesn't call qmp_object_add(), but calls user_creatable_add_dict()
directly instead and pass it a new keyval boolean that decides which
visitor must be used.
